Today’s Sunday Praise and Worship verse is:

“For I am not ashamed of the gospel of Christ, for it is the power of God to salvation for everyone who believes, for the Jew first and also for the Greek.” (Romans 1:16)

I chose this mostly based on a incident that had happen earlier in the week, that got me thinking about being a follower of Christ; I had mention to someone how it would be so great to have a live stream of the church sermon so if I was out of town, I could catch it on the laptop, plus I really wanted to get an ipod so I can download my pastor’s sermons to listen to for further reflection and for when I wanted to remember something to look up in the bible.

I was told,”You know, we had a skit about this for one sermon how it’s okay to take a vacation from church sometimes.” This isn’t an exact quote, but it did get me thinking; As a follower of Christ, we are 24/7 ambassadors of Christ. God is always there for us 24/7 but we can’t treat Him like once we go home, close our door, He is no longer there.

It bothered me that because I wanted to get to know the Lord more, I should just “take a rest.” For me, Our Heavenly Father has done so much for me, and I, I have so little really to give to Him; I don’t feel worthy to be His servant and Praise God that He can and does use this broken vessel for His purposes and glory.

I feel like Ezra and the Bereans, who couldn’t get enough of God and sought Him daily in His word and in prayer; Why should we be any different in the 21st century? Why should we be any better? We are all still sinners and to hunger for Him and to seek Him, is to understand Him better and to know how to embrace Him better.

He is in us, living through us and around us 24/7; He doesn’t close His eyes and ears from us and Adam and Eve learned that even they couldn’t hide from God, so why do we sometimes live our lives like we can; That we can pick and choose when we are Christ followers and when we are not.

For me…to say we are tired of this “God stuff” and leave it for just Sunday, is the same as saying as great as what He has done for us, we don’t really appreciate exactly what He has done.

My MIL, in a conversation with my child, replied to his ever, “I wanna see Jesus now,” that she was proud to be a Jesus freak and it was okay to want to be with Him all the time; We should worry when we stop wanting to be with Him. If we aren’t ashamed to call Him our Lord and Saviour, why be ashamed of living for Him daily and if that means reading Scripture, listening to sermons, to seek to have a closer relationship, so be it, this is not a personal relationship reserved for only a select few.

He seeks a personal relationship with you, me, everyone and there is nothing wrong putting Him first before all in our lives; That is showing Him the praise and glory that is reserved and belongs to Him and to Him only.

Greg Laurie has a daily devotional and one of them was called, “Not Ashamed” and it went:

We are living in a time in which people stand up for a variety of causes. People stand up for everything imaginable, and in some cases, they are even willing to lay down their lives for what they believe. Although we may not agree with what they are saying in some cases, we have to admire their courage for believing in something so strongly that they are willing to risk their lives for it.

Isn’t it time that we, as Christians, stand up for what we believe? Romans 10:9 says that “if you confess with your mouth the Lord Jesus and believe in your heart that God has raised Him from the dead, you will be saved.”

What does it mean to confess the Lord Jesus? The very word confess gives us a clue. It is a word that means, “to be in agreement with.”

When I am confessing Jesus Christ, I am not merely acknowledging that He existed, nor am I just acknowledging that He is God. When I confess Jesus Christ before others, I am saying that I agree with Him.

It is not enough to simply acknowledge that He has power and that He is moving in the lives of certain people. There must be a personal acknowledgement that I have received Him as my own Savior and Lord.

In a day when so many are standing up for so many causes, it seems to me there are so many in the church who are not standing up for anything. Let’s be willing to stand up and confess Jesus Christ before others.
